Identifying the Battery Type

Fossil watches typically use quartz batteries, which are designed to provide accurate timekeeping and long battery life. The most common types of batteries used in Fossil watches include SR920SW, SR626SW, and SR716SW. To determine the type of battery your watch uses, check the back of the watch case for the battery type or consult your watch’s manual.

Checking the Watch’s Water Resistance

If your Fossil watch is water-resistant, it is crucial to check the watch’s water resistance rating before attempting to replace the battery. Water-resistant watches have special seals and gaskets that can be damaged if not handled properly. Improper replacement of the battery can compromise the watch’s water resistance, which can lead to damage or malfunction.

Replacing the Battery

With your tools and workspace ready, you can begin replacing the battery. Follow these steps carefully to ensure a successful replacement:

To replace the battery, follow these steps:

  • Open the watch case using a watch case opener. Gently pry the case open, taking care not to damage the watch’s internal mechanisms.
  • Locate the battery and remove it using a battery removal tool. Be careful not to touch any of the watch’s internal components.
  • Inspect the battery compartment and remove any debris or old adhesive.
  • Insert the new battery, making sure it is properly seated and secured.
  • Close the watch case, ensuring it is properly sealed and water-resistant.

What tools do I need to change the battery in my Fossil watch?

To change the battery in your Fossil watch, you will need a few basic tools. The most important tool is a watch battery replacement kit, which can be purchased at a jewelry store or online. This kit usually includes a new battery, a battery removal tool, and instructions. You may also need a soft cloth, a pair of tweezers, and a small screwdriver, depending on the type of watch you have. It’s also a good idea to have a magnifying glass or a loupe to help you see the small parts of the watch.

In addition to these tools, you should also make sure you have a clean and stable work surface to perform the battery replacement. A desk or table with a soft cloth or padding can help prevent scratching or damaging the watch. It’s also a good idea to have a container or tray to hold the small parts of the watch, such as the screws or the old battery, to prevent them from getting lost. How do I open the back of my Fossil watch?

To open the back of your Fossil watch, you will need to locate the small screws or clips that hold it in place. For most Fossil watches, you will need to use a small screwdriver to remove the screws. Be careful not to strip the screws, and make sure to keep track of them as you remove them. Some Fossil watches may have a clip or a hinge that holds the back in place, in which case you will need to use a small tool or your fingers to release the clip. Once you have removed the screws or released the clip, you should be able to gently pry the back of the watch open.

As you open the back of the watch, be careful not to touch any of the internal components, as the oils from your skin can damage the watch’s mechanisms. You should also be careful not to pull on any of the wires or cables, as this can cause damage to the watch’s electronics. How do I remove the old battery from my Fossil watch?

To remove the old battery from your Fossil watch, you will need to use a battery removal tool. This tool is usually included in the watch battery replacement kit, and it is specifically designed to safely and easily remove the old battery from the watch. Simply insert the tool into the battery compartment and gently pry the old battery out. Be careful not to touch any of the internal components of the watch, and avoid using any sharp objects or tools that may damage the watch’s mechanisms.

As you remove the old battery, take note of the position and orientation of the battery in the compartment. This will help you to install the new battery correctly and ensure that it is properly seated and secured. You should also take care to handle the old battery safely and dispose of it properly. Many communities have designated recycling programs for batteries, and it’s a good idea to participate in these programs to help protect the environment.
